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: PSOSUSRP

Package: Outpatient Pharmacy

Routine: PSOSUSRP


Information

PSOSUSRP ;BHAM ISC/RTR-Reprint label driver routine ;SEP 30, 2020@13:11

Source Information

Source file <PSOSUSRP.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
VA FileMan 2 NOW^%DTC  ^DIK  
Kernel 1 ^%ZISC  
Outpatient Pharmacy 1 DQ^PSOLBL  
Registration 1 DEM^VADPT  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Outpatient Pharmacy 2 PSOLBL  PSOLLLI  

Entry Points

Name Comments DBIA/ICR reference
BEG ;
END
AREC ;

External References

Name Field # of Occurrence
NOW^%DTC AREC+4
^%ZISC END
^DIK BEG+6
DQ^PSOLBL BEG+9, BEG+15
DEM^VADPT BEG+6

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^PS(52.5 - [#52.5]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^PS(52.5 - [#52.5] BEG+5, BEG+6, BEG+7, BEG+8, BEG+14, BEG+18, AREC+2, AREC+3
^PSRX - [#52] AREC+5, AREC+6, AREC+7*
^UTILITY($J BEG+1, BEG+4, END!

Label References

Name Line Occurrences
END BEG+1

Naked Globals

Name Field # of Occurrence
^(0 BEG+5, BEG+14, BEG+18

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> % AREC+4
AAAA BEG+4*, BEG+5, END!
BBBB BEG+4*, BEG+5, END!
CCCC BEG+4*, BEG+5, END!
>> CNT AREC+5*, AREC+7*
>> COM AREC+4*, AREC+7
>> DA BEG+6*
DDDD BEG+5*, END!
DFN BEG+6*!
>> DIK BEG+6*
>> DTTM AREC+4*, AREC+7
DUZ BEG+9, BEG+15
EEEE BEG+5*, BEG+6, BEG+7, BEG+8, END!
FFF BEG+10*, BEG+16*, END!
FFFF BEG+10*, BEG+16*, END!
GGGG BEG+14*, BEG+18*, END!
HHHH BEG+14*, BEG+18*, END!
HLDDEAD BEG+6*, END!
>> JJ AREC+5*
MMMM BEG+14*, BEG+18*, END!
NNNN BEG+14*, BEG+18*, END!
NPATIENT BEG+8*, END!
OPATIENT BEG+7*, BEG+8*, END!
PATIFLAG BEG+2*, BEG+7*, END!
>> PDUZ BEG+9*, BEG+15*, AREC+7
PPL BEG+9*!, BEG+10, BEG+14, BEG+15*, BEG+16, BEG+18, END!
PSOREDEV BEG+3~*, BEG+9, BEG+15
PSOREEP AREC+2*, AREC+3, AREC+8!
PSOREEPF AREC+2*, AREC+4, AREC+8!
>> PSOSUREP BEG+9*, BEG+15*
RECOUNT BEG+2*, BEG+8*, BEG+9*, END!
REHLDPPL BEG+8*, BEG+9!, BEG+15, END!
REPCOUNT BEG+10*, BEG+14, BEG+16*, BEG+18, END!
>> RF AREC+6*
>> RFCNT AREC+6*, AREC+7
RFLNUM AREC+1~, AREC+3*, AREC+7
>> RX AREC+2, AREC+5, AREC+6, AREC+7
RXFL BEG+9!, BEG+15!, END!
RXFL( BEG+14*, BEG+18*
>> RXP AREC+4, AREC+7
RXPR BEG+9!, END!
RXPR( BEG+14*, BEG+18*
RXRP BEG+3~, BEG+9!, END!
RXRP( BEG+14*, BEG+18*
>> VA("BID" BEG+6!
>> VA("PID" BEG+6!
VADM BEG+6!
VADM(6 BEG+6
>> ZTIO BEG+3, BEG+9*, BEG+15*
>> ZTQUEUED END
>> ZTREQ END*
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All